UAE transit risk now reaches Dubai and Abu Dhabi layovers. Australia now advises against travel to the United Arab Emirates, including transit and layovers, while warning that UAE airspace may open or close at short notice. Travelers already booked through Dubai International Airport (DXB) or Zayed International Airport (AUH) should check insurance, avoid separate tickets, and price non-UAE alternatives before departure.

Haiti’s May airspace reopening is limited to potential Dominican Republic links with Cap-Haïtien, not a broad return of Haiti access. Port-au-Prince remains under U.S. flight restrictions through September 3, 2026, and travelers should not treat northern air service as a safe capital workaround.

Celebrity Constellation guests now have a different end point for the April 27 Italy and Croatia sailing. The ship is scheduled to disembark in Trieste, not Ravenna, on May 8 after a Ravenna berthing conflict tied to construction delays. Independent travelers should recheck flights, trains, hotels, transfers, rental cars, and private tours before making new purchases.

Seattle ferry travelers should plan around queues, not schedules, as delays build before May 1 fare hikes. Crew shortages on the Bainbridge route, emergency repair work at Fauntleroy, and smaller vessel assignments in the San Juans can turn one missed sailing into a broken airport, cruise, hotel, or tour plan.

Spain tower strike risk remains active through May 31 at nine SAERCO managed airports, including Lanzarote, Fuerteventura, La Palma, El Hierro, Seville, Jerez, Vigo, A Coruña, and Madrid-Cuatro Vientos. Minimum service rules should keep many flights operating, but tight connections and island arrivals remain exposed.
